SPEEDING
“I have no explanation at all,” said John ATKINSON  (34), aerial erector,
Mitchell Avenue, Northside, Workington, when told by P. C.  READ that he had
traveled up to 45 m.p.h. in his van at Distington. The van was  limited to 30
m.p.h.

A LORRY & 3 CARS.

Three cars were badly damaged in an unusual accident  in Portland Square,
Workington, last Friday night. The cars were all parked at  the top end of the
square, side by side, when a lorry driver, looking for a  parking place, tried
to drive the vehicle round them.
